During my time at Ford in the 90's and 00's we had numerous issues with Goodyear. They were just not quality tires for the most part, and on the purchasing side they were a bunch of hard to work with jerks.  (Constantly trying to re-negotiate after the supply agreements were signed,  threatening to withhold tires from the plant if we did not agree, amongst other things.)  With the Firestone fiasco and then Goodyear issues it really forced us to look at other brands.  Don't know how this Ford/Goodyear relationship is now, though.

 

On the P415 program I worked on (09-14 F-150) we even had to bring Hankook into the mix which I hated.  They were cheap (both in price and quality) but we needed something for the lower end XL's and STX's to save a few bucks.  Like with this Bronco / Goodyear Wrangler discussion we didn't make Hankook take their name off the tires but we did ensure only black outline letters were used.  We would not put white outline letters of "Hankook" on our all-American F-150.  :)
